Brie Bella was noticeably grabbing her right shoulder during a six-woman tag team match at WWE SummerSlam on Saturday night as she appeared to suffer an injury.
Bella was seated next to the steel steps when her opponent, Jacy Jayne, hit a running senton on her. At that moment, she began to clutch her shoulder and kept rubbing it during the rest of the match with her sister Nikki Bella and Paige.

Nikki Bella attacked Paige at the end of the match, signaling a villainous turn to their characters. She provided an update on Brie in an interview on Busted Open Radio on Sunday before the second night of the premium live event began.
"She’s doing OK. She is in a lot of pain," Nikki Bella said of Brie. "They are still determining what’s going on. Brie will share that whenever. … I’ve been told to ‘zip it.’"
WWE Chief Content Officer Paul "Triple H" Levesque told reporters after Night 1 that the injury "seems pretty bad."

"Yeah, she’s injured," he said. "I don’t have an update yet. We’ve taken her. She was here, got some treatment done here, has been taken to the hospital to get some scans done. Don’t have a clean answer on it yet.
"I know she hurt her shoulder. It seems pretty bad, but I don’t have an answer yet. Hopefully we will soon.
